Ministry of Health announced 11 new COVID-19 cases

28/08/2020 09:21

Cyprus’ Ηealth Ministry announced on Thursday 11 new COVID-19 cases, after conducting 2,755 laboratory tests. The total number of COVID-19 positive cases in Cyprus rose to 1,467.

Five cases were found among passengers returning to Cyprus, from a total of 1,619 tests. Three of them came from Budapest, Hungary on 26 August and they are related.  They don’t have any symptoms. The other two came from Debrecen, Hungary on 26 August and they are not related.

Out of 125 tests from contact-tracing, four cases were detected. One of them is the wife of a confirmed case, who has symptoms. The second person is a contact of his parents (announced on 19 August and 21 August and had a travel history) and he also has symptoms. The other two people are from the family environment of the same case and they both have symptoms.

Moreover, out of 621 individuals who did the test privately, two cases were detected.  The first person came from the USA on 16 August and took the test before starting his quarantine. He tested positive, but has no symptoms. The second person took the test privately because her employer requested it. She also has no symptoms.

No cases were found after 166 tests done at Microbiological Labs of General Hospitals, 99 tests at the crossing points, 2 tests from the residents of Kato Pyrgos Tyllirias, 1 test under the control program of the Ministry of Justice for staff working in the Courts and 125 tests under the program of referrals by Personal Doctors and control of special groups through the Public Health Clinics.

Four patients are currently being treated at the Famagusta General Hospital one of which in the intensive care unit. One patient was discharged yesterday. One patient remains intubated in the intensive care unit at the Nicosia General Hospital.
